Factors Affecting Cost
- Extent of Damage: Larger areas of damage will require more materials and labor, increasing the overall cost.
- Material Type: The type of siding material (wood, vinyl, fiber cement) can significantly affect repair costs.
- Labor Rates: Local labor rates in Saint Peters, MO, can vary, impacting the final price.
- Accessibility: Hard-to-reach areas may require special equipment or additional labor, raising costs.
- Permits and Inspections: Some repairs may require permits or inspections, which add to the expense.
- Weather Conditions: Adverse weather can delay repairs and increase labor costs due to extended project timelines.
Common Tasks and Costs
Task | Average Cost (in Saint Peters, MO) |
---|---|
Minor Crack Repairs | $100 - $300 |
Replacing Damaged Panels | $200 - $500 per panel |
Full Section Replacement | $1,000 - $3,000 |
Repainting After Repair | $400 - $1,200 |
Inspection and Permit Fees | $50 - $150 |
Labor Costs (per hour) | $50 - $100 |
